
Navigate the remote, tide-heavy waters of Canada's Arctic subregion with the official Canadian Hydrographic Service (CHS) Chart 5348, detailing the Approaches to Hopes Advance Bay. Situated along the western shores of Ungava Bay in northern Quebec, this high-precision navigational chart is an indispensable asset for commercial shipping vessels, research expeditions, and northern mariners tracking these complex Arctic waters.
Engineered at a scale of 1:75,000, this map offers specialized coverage required to handle the region's extreme tidal ranges, erratic weather conditions, and seasonal ice.
